Starbucks customers are complaining that a small cup of coffeeat a local Starbucks coffee shop does not contain as much coffee asit should (i.e., it contains less coffee than advertised). Onaverage, Starbucks claims that a small cup of coffee contains 360grams of coffee. The customers decide to order 20 cups of coffee atrandom times; on average their cups contained 356 grams, and astandard deviation of 9 grams. What is the critical value for thetest using 𝛼 = .05?
